Shinkansen bullet trains to have Wi-Fi facilityThe passengers who are traveling in famous Japanese Shinkansen ‘bullet trains’ will be able to access Internet while traveling at 300kph. But they to wait until the first wireless LAN train comes on the platform.



According to Central Japan Railway, that operates the Shinkansen service between Tokyo and the western Japanese city of Osaka, there is a plan to offer Wireless Internet service in all cars of its new N700-series trains.



The Internet service is supplied by a leaky coaxial cable that runs alongside the train tracks. A similar analog system is ready to provide basic communications and radio channel, which is re broadcast in the train. This new system is digital, which will carry internet traffic.



The upgraded communication will offer other benefits also. The internal mobile phone service is provided to driver and guard to speak with each other at any time.
